Valdez High School musicians returned from the annual Aurora Music Festival last weekend with great experiences and several honors. The Aurora Music Festival is a gathering of fifteen high schools from the Alaska road system and Cordova and Unalaska—all small schools with big hearts for music. Five hundred ten students gathered at Houston High School, this year’s host.
Valdez musicians had a busy weekend as they rehearsed in Mass Band and Choir and Honor Band and Choir, adjudicated as VHS Band and Choir, and presented solos and ensembles which competed for State qualification.
